IT Technician
Job Purpose: To provide technical support, system maintenance, and IT solutions to ensure the smooth and secure operation of the companys technology infrastructure and client-facing systems. Key Responsibilities: Install, configure, and maintain computer hardware, software, networks, and systems. Provide first- and second-line support to staff and clients, diagnosing and resolving technical issues. Monitor and maintain network security, data backups, and system performance. Set up accounts, user access, and permissions in line with company policies. Support the rollout of new applications, systems, and IT projects. Document IT processes, troubleshooting steps, and technical solutions. Liaise with third-party providers and vendors for IT services and procurement. Train staff on systems, software, and IT best practices. Ensure compliance with data protection and cybersecurity standards. Contribute to continuous improvement of IT systems and services. Skills & Qualifications: Proven experience as an IT Technician, IT Support Engineer, or similar role. Strong knowledge of computer systems, networks, operating systems, and security. Familiarity with server administration, cloud platforms, and Microsoft Office 365. Excellent problem-solving and communication skills.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ities. Relevant IT qualifications (CompTIA, Microsoft, Cisco, or equivalent) preferred. Salary: £41,700 per annum (as per Skilled Worker route requirements). Hours: Full-time, 37.5 hours per week.
